Divorce Proceedings in California: Your Rights Explained detailed

Navigating a divorce can be challenging, especially when it involves complex legal processes. In California, the process of dissolving a marriage is governed by specific laws and regulations designed to protect the rights of both parties involved. Understanding these fundamental rights is crucial for securing a fair and equitable outcome.

One key right during divorce proceedings in California is the right to request proper representation. It is strongly recommended to retain an experienced family law attorney who can assist you through the intricacies of the legal system and represent your interests.

  • Another important right involves financial transparency. Both spouses are required to thoroughly disclose their financial condition, including income, assets, debts, and expenses.
  • California is a community property state, meaning that any possessions acquired during the marriage are generally considered to be owned equally by both spouses. Splitting of community property is often a central point in divorce proceedings.
  • In some cases, one spouse may demand spousal alimony. This type of financial assistance is intended to help the financially dependent spouse adapt to life after the divorce.

It's important to remember that these are just a few of the key rights involved in California divorce proceedings. The specific facts of each case can vary widely, so it is always best to consult with an experienced family law attorney for personalized legal advice and assistance.

Southern California Spousal Support: What You Need to Know

Navigating legal separation can be a complex process, especially when it comes to spousal support. In California, payments of funds from one spouse to another after the end of the relationship are governed by specific regulations.

  • Factors such as the timeframe of the marriage, each individual's earning potential, and quality of life are thoroughly analyzed when determining the amount and length of time of spousal support.
  • Interim support may be ordered during the dissolution process, while permanent support is determined in some instances.
  • Modifying spousal support agreements can be possible under certain circumstances, such as a material change in the economic status of either spouse.

Seeking advice from an experienced family law attorney is highly recommended to comprehend your rights and possibilities regarding spousal support in California.
